从 Ubuntu 16.04 LTS 升级到 18.04 LTS(统一)后,击键Shift + Alt + Down
并Alt + Shift + Ctrl + Down
停止工作(顺便说一句Alt + Shift + (Ctrl) + [Up, Left, Right]
有效)。
我在 PHPStorm/Webstorm 中使用了这些键绑定。在这些程序中,您可以通过简单地按下这些键来搜索键绑定的作用,当我这样做时,Webstorm 不会显示/捕获这些击键,就像它们没有被按下一样。
我在 CompizConfig 设置管理器高级搜索中的设置值、设置/键盘/快捷方式和 with 中进行了搜索,gsettings list-recursively | grep Down
但没有找到任何内容。
如果我在 Webstorm 之外按下这个组合,Ubuntu 什么也不做。
你知道这个键绑定可以保存在哪里吗?
PS:我试过这个工具(screenkey)来显示按下的键。但它没有显示Alt + Shift + Down
或Alt + Shift + Ctrl + Down
谢谢您的帮助
Gnome Tweaks 帮助我修复它!
关闭“切换到另一个布局”的所有选项。
就我而言,幸运的是,它只是重新映射设置->键盘->快捷方式中的键。
在这里,将活动窗口向上/向下移动定义为 Shift+Super+Page Up/Down,同样没有 Shift 用于向上/向下移动一个工作区。
重新映射到我习惯的([Shift+]Ctrl+Alt+Up/Down)就可以了:-)
我最近遇到了类似的问题,同时尝试在 Ubuntu 20.04 中的 vscodium 中使用此组合键
ctrl+ shift+ alt+up或down不按我的意愿工作,因为它改变了工作空间而不是代码编辑器中的预期功能
第一种方法
试图通过以下方式修复它:
活动 > 设置 > 键盘快捷键
导航 > 移动到上方/下方的工作区
也没有用,因为这个键组合:ctrl + shift + alt + up/down,不在那里显示
解决方案
安装 dconf 编辑器
去:
禁用使用默认值
编辑自定义值:通过删除
申请
按照相同的步骤向上(而不是向下)
登出/登入
结果
<Supper><PageUp>
上下<Supper><PageDown>
工作区的键键。您实际上可以从键盘快捷键设置中更改此快捷键对于 Gnome Shell,工作区阻碍了工作。甚至键盘快捷键也与 Phpstorm 有所不同(在我的情况下,
shift
修饰符不是 Gnome shell 快捷键绑定的一部分),工作区向上/向下阻止了 Phpstorm 中的键绑定。所以对于 Gnome Shell,禁用动态工作区:
将(现在是静态的)工作区的数量设置为 1:
禁用阻止 Phpstorm 的向上/向下键盘快捷键:
这些修复与键盘无关,我可以确认不这样做会有热键
Ctrl+Alt+Shift+Up
,Ctrl+Alt+Shift+Down
和在 PhpstormCtrl+Alt+Up
中Ctrl+Alt+Down
不起作用,因为 Gnome Shell 会阻止它们。我只是偶然发现了这个问题,并在我的博客(Gnome Shell Quickfix Cheatsheet)中记下了笔记。
经过深入调查,我发现这个问题是硬件键盘问题。我在 Windows 上尝试了这个键击,它也没有被识别。
我有 Roccat Isku 键盘。在工作中,我尝试了从 16.04 到 18 的相同升级,并用统一替换 gnome 并且这个击键有效(我有不同的键盘在工作)
我在 Zorin OS 上遇到了同样的问题。这些都没有帮助。我有 G613 键盘,我已经测试了按键。尽管其中一些不被识别,Alt并且Shift是。
帮助我的是在键盘和鼠标菜单的附加布局选项子菜单下的 Gnome Tweaks 工具中检查切换到另一个布局 Alt+Shift复选框。